Bastille Day is the national holiday of France, celebrated annually on July 14th. It commemorates the 1789 storming of the Bastille, a pivotal event in the French Revolution that symbolized the collapse of the absolute monarchy. Today, it is marked by military parades, fireworks, and public festivities.
